      Wind tunnel tests conducted by specialist engineers have shown that if the tent design is too rigid, extreme wind speeds can push the construction beyond its performance limits. When developing the ASYLUM, our new alpine expedition tent, we therefore decided to combine our REAL TUNNEL and REAL DOME designs to create a geodesic hybrid that was both stable enough and flexible enough to withstand storm force winds.

      Both constructions utilise variable diameter pole sections that flex in a specific way. In the REAL TUNNEL design, the lower segments of the poles are more stable, while the REAL DOME poles sections are stronger in the roof area. Combining the two designs gives the ASYLUM the desired stability and flexibility at critical areas of the geodesic construction.

      In tests, this REAL TUNNEL DOME construction was able to withstand wind speeds of up to 130 km/h without sustaining any damage. In light winds, the tent is perfectly stable without the guylines and since it is also built to withstand snow loading, it is highly suitable for winter and high mountain use.

      Additional advantages of the design are the generous internal space, courtesy of the steeper sides, and optimal use of the available space in the vestibule area. Best quality fabrics, like the extremely light and tough SILICON HT NYLON RIPSTOP 40D, and a superb build quality make the tent extremely reliable. It is also equipped with all round storm flaps for winter use and to deliver extra protection in high winds.
